Ministry introduces "Notice to contest" for traffic tickets

Postby Duane 3NE 2NR » November 9th, 2017, 2:44 pm

The Legislative Amendments to the Motor Vehicle and Road Traffic Act will introduce a system whereby ticketed offenders are given the opportunity to file a Notice to contest the ticket.
